After taking the machine to a local "engineer" customer stated that "copious" amounts of thermal paste was applied to the CPU contributing to the "systems failure" and "many error codes". Having just recently built this PC I remember exactly how much paste was installed. One super thin layer covering the whole dye, spread as thin as possible using a spreader while still giving coverage. This method is much more effective for the AMD CPU's as the whole component can generate heat. The often used "pea sized" method just covering the center is decently effective for Intel CPU's but not as ideal for AMD CPUs. As cant be seen by the fact their own manufactured coolers come with thermal paste applied in this method. I'm presuming the customers "engineer" wasn't aware of this. This brought into question my faith in the "abilities" of this engineer as regardless a little extra paste would not cause "system failures" and "error codes".
